CodeRunner is an action-packed, immersive experience, but it is important to remember at all times that it is a game and that staying safe is your most important mission.
ON YOUR MISSIONS
- Stay out of danger. All mission destinations can be regenerated. Regenerate until you get a location you feel safe visiting.
- No Rush. You’re not on a timer–all missions can be completed at your leisure. If you need to wait for a traffic signal, wait! Don’t try to rush through traffic!
- Report Inappropriate Drops. Playing CodeRunner should be safe and enjoyable. If you come across a drop that you think is inappropriate or unsafe, use the “Rate This Drop” feature to report it.
MAKING DEAD DROPS
Keep in mind some basic guidelines for making dead drops:
- Local laws always apply. If you want to leave a physical drop, be mindful of local laws and common courtesy.
- Do not deface property or trespass.
- Get permission. Do not leave a physical drop without the permission of the property owner (in the case of private property) or the agency or organization who manages the property (in the case of public property).
- Do not arouse suspicion. You’re a spy! Don’t loiter or draw unwanted attention. On top of making you a poor spy, it could also draw the attention of local authorities who shouldn’t have to be distracted by people playing a mobile game.
- If you’re not sure, don’t do it. If you’re not sure about leaving a drop somewhere, don’t do it. There are a lot of ways to make interesting and fun drops without leaving a physical drop and a lot of places where leaving a physical drop is appropriate and safe.
Be smart. Be respectful. Play safe!
